Actor Michael J. Fox was recognized with early-onset Parkinson’s illness in 1991 when he was simply 29. In an interview with “CBS Sunday Morning” anchor Jane Pauley, Fox, now 61, says coping with the incurable illness is getting tougher, and he cannot think about residing till he is 80.

The revealing and emotional interview might be broadcast on “CBS Sunday Morning” April 30 and streamed on Paramount+.

In a wide-ranging dialog, Fox talks with Pauley about his life at the moment; the latest breakthrough in analysis introduced by his basis figuring out a genetic biomarker that might result in earlier prognosis; and the way, with gratitude, optimism is sustainable.

FOX: I had spinal surgical procedure. I had a tumor on my backbone. And – and – and it was benign, but it surely tousled my strolling. … After which, began to interrupt stuff. Bro, broke this arm, and I broke this arm, I broke this elbow. I broke my face. I broke my hand.

PAULEY: Falling on issues?

FOX:  Which is an enormous killer with Parkinson’s. It is falling … and aspirating meals and getting pneumonia. All these refined ways in which will get ya’. … You do not die from Parkinson’s. You die with Parkinson’s. So – so I have been – I have been fascinated by the mortality of it. … I am not gonna be 80. I am not gonna be 80.
